1. 关联规则大家可能听说过用于宣传数据挖掘的一个案例:啤酒和尿布;据说是沃尔玛超市在分析顾客的购买记录时,发现许多客户购买啤酒的同时也会购买婴儿尿布,于是超市调整了啤酒和尿布的货架摆放,让这两个品类摆放在一起;结果这两个品类的销量都有明显的增长;分析原因是很多刚生小孩的男士在购买的啤酒时,会顺手带一些婴幼儿用品。不论这个案例是否是真实的,案例中分析顾客购买记录的方式就是关联规则分析法Associ
转载
2023-08-31 08:11:25
147阅读
分表
为什么分表
多表关联
多表关系 ******
表之间的关系
为什么要分表
多对一
一个外键
多对多
一个中间表 两个外键
一对一
一个外键加一个唯一约束
外键约束 ******
foreign key(自己的字段) references 表名(对方的主键)
级联操作***
on up
转载
2023-08-06 13:33:24
54阅读
一、什么是关系型数据库 关系型数据库以行和列的形式存储数据,以便于用户理解。这一系列的行和列被称为表,一组表组成了数据库。表与表之间的数据记录有关系。现实世界中的各种实体以及实体之间的各种联系均用关系模型来表示。 二。表、记录、字段实体-联系(E-R)模型中有三个主要概念是:实体集、联系集、属性。 一个实体集对应于数据库中的一个表table,一个实体则
如果同学不喜欢看理论,可以直接看后面王者数据分析的部分。关联规则如果不知道尿布和啤酒问题,建议 百度百科 ,先有个大致的了解 我们找百度百科上面的例子来讲一下 tid是交易单号,后面每一纵列中1代表购买,0代表没买。 我们只需要明白 支持度==概率(只有这个支持度足够大,说明我们选出的集合买的人多,对于商家的价值也就越大) 置信度==条件概率(这是算关联程度的) 关联规则挖掘过程主要包含两个阶
转载
2024-07-23 17:10:39
18阅读
# Python中的模型关联与数据表
在现代软件开发中,特别是在Web应用和数据分析领域,数据模型与数据库之间的关联关系至关重要。使用Python的框架,如Django或Flask,可以帮助我们更加高效地管理这些关系。在本文中,我们将介绍模型关联的基本概念,并通过示例代码展示如何在Python中实现这种关系。
## 什么是模型关联?
在数据库中,模型关联是指不同数据表(model)之间的关系
原创
2024-08-10 05:05:25
110阅读
在这个博文中,我将探讨如何解决使用 Python 的 SQLAlchemy 进行表之间关联的问题。SQLAlchemy 是一个强大且灵活的 ORM 库,它能够简化数据库操作,但如果不理解关联表的概念,可能会面临一些挑战。随着时间的推移,越来越多的开发者开始转向 SQLAlchemy 来管理他们的数据库,然而表之间的关系却常常让人捉襟见肘。
> 引用块:
> “SQLAlchemy 是一个 P
1.自定义主键字段的创建 一般不自定义主键.2.order_by asc descfrom django.db.models.function import Lowerres = Student.objects.order_by(Lower('name').desc())表关系的创建OneToOne #一般情况下关联表名用字符串,防止无法读取Student这个类.OneToMany grade =
转载
2024-10-07 16:29:44
38阅读
一、外键foreign key 外键约束: 1、必须先创建被关联表才能创建关联表2、插入记录时,必须先插入被关联表的记录,才能插入关联表(要用到被关联表)的记录3、若不设置同步更新和同步删除,更新和删除都会受到限制 #表类型必须是innodb存储引擎,且被关联的字段,即references指定的另外一个表的字段,必须保证唯一
create tabl
转载
2023-10-01 08:26:30
141阅读
在数据处理和分析的过程中,懂得如何使用 Python 关联表是非常重要的,这可以让我们从不同的数据表中提取有用的信息。但在实际操作中,我们时常会遇到一些问题。接下来我将分享一下我解决“Python 如何关联表”的过程,希望对大家有所帮助。
### 问题背景
在使用 Python 处理数据库时,我们常常需要对多个数据表进行关联,以便提取相关信息。以下是我们在项目中遇到的问题背景:
- **数据
在实际业务场景中,我们常常会探讨到产品的关联性分析,本篇文章将会介绍一下如何在Python环境下如何利用apriori算法进行数据分析。1.准备工作如果需要在Python环境下实现apriori算法,就离不开一个关键的机器学习库mlxtend,运行以下代码进行安装:pip install mlxtend为方便进行过程的演示,在此构建测试数据:import pandas as pd
df=pd.Da
转载
2023-06-26 12:45:42
143阅读
# Python中如何进行表关联的实现
在现代数据分析和开发中,处理数据库中的相关数据是一个非常常见的需求。尤其是在使用Python进行数据分析时,能够合理地进行表关联(JOIN)操作至关重要。本文将通过一个实际的例子,展示如何使用Python中的`pandas`库来实现表的关联,并通过流程图和类图进行可视化说明。
## 实际问题
假设我们在一家电商公司工作,需要分析客户的订单信息和客户的基
Many-to-many relationalships之前我们接触的都是one-many的关系,从来没有接触过many-many的关系,一对多的关系如下图所示: tracks(单曲)属于album,一个album可能会有多个tracks知识点1 什么是多对多关系 如上图所示,一本书可能有多个作者,一个作者可能写了多本书,因此在建立关系的时候不能简单使用一个外键来表示,需要在中间建立一个Junct
转载
2023-12-12 11:52:48
50阅读
1. 表与表之间的关系:一对多;一对一;多对多;表与表之间怎么建立一对一的关系呢,可以使用外键约束+唯一约束;有两种方式:1.利用主键,一张表的主键只能有一个,所以这张表就可以满足唯一,另一张表跟前面那张表的主键关联的字段设置为外键,并且该外键字段设置为唯一字段(也就是当两张表关联的两个字段之一是一张表的主键,则另一张表相应字段设置为外键+唯一约束即可);---用户-博客表(假设一个
转载
2023-08-19 18:53:53
311阅读
分表
为什么分表
多表关联
多表关系 ******
表之间的关系
为什么要分表
多对一
一个外键
多对多
一个中间表 两个外键
一对一
一个外键加一个唯一约束
外键约束 ******
foreign key(自己的字段) references 表名(对方的主键)
级联操作***
on up
转载
2024-04-01 10:50:03
13阅读
首先由Apriori算法生成频繁项集及对应的支持度,后根据频繁项集产生规则。其中频繁项集的产生较为简单,只要运用python的set(集合),可以很方便的解决集合取并集、交集,子集的情况。要比使用list方便很多,减少代码量。后面产生规则时要使用递归,代码较短,但较为难以理解,现已加较多注释解释,可以跳过Apriori产生频繁项集实现的代码片段,直接看产生规则的代码片段,也就是后三个函数。def
转载
2024-02-26 20:11:52
35阅读
# Python表关联多个key的实现方法
## 概述
在Python中,我们经常需要处理多个表格(或称为数据框)之间的关联操作。这些表格通常包含不同的数据字段,并且我们需要根据某些字段的值将它们连接起来。本文将介绍如何在Python中实现表格之间的关联操作,并使用多个关联键将它们连接起来。
## 整体流程
下面是完成这个任务的整体流程:
| 步骤 | 描述 |
| --- | --- |
原创
2023-10-04 03:45:55
137阅读
# Python 数据表关联:大于匹配
在数据分析和处理领域,表关联是一项非常基本且重要的操作。尤其是在使用 Python 进行数据分析时,我们经常需要根据某些条件将不同的数据表联系起来,以便提取有用的信息。本文将重点介绍如何在 Python 中进行表关联,并演示一种特定的关联情况——“大于匹配”。
## 表关联的基本概念
在数据分析中,表关联通常是指将两个或多个数据表根据某些条件连接在一起
原创
2024-09-03 04:51:34
27阅读
我们来为货物建一张表,其中包含规格、名称、生产厂家等等信息,如下: 可以看到这里存在大量冗余信息,比如厂家的名称、地址、电话等就在表中重复多次, 这会带来如下的问题: 1,信息冗余占据空间。数据的存储是占据一定的空间的,如果存在过多冗余信息将会使得存储系统的利用率过低。 2,信息冗余使得新数据的加入
转载
2018-10-19 23:58:00
228阅读
2评论
# Python实现两表关联
在数据分析和数据库操作中,经常会遇到需要关联两张表的情况。关联是指根据两张表中的共同字段,将它们合并成一张新表的过程。Python提供了多种方法来实现两表关联,包括使用pandas库和使用SQL语句。
## 1. 使用pandas库进行两表关联
pandas是一个强大的数据分析库,它提供了丰富的数据结构和数据操作功能。其中,`merge()`函数可以用于将两个D
原创
2023-08-01 03:26:07
914阅读
# Python 表关联与模糊条件匹配
在数据处理中,表关联是一个常见的操作,尤其在数据库或数据框(DataFrame)的使用中。通过表关联,可以将不同的数据集整合到一起,从而提供更加全面的信息。而模糊条件匹配则是在进行数据查询时,允许字符串或数据具有一定的误差范围,以找到最接近的匹配。
本文将介绍如何在Python中通过`pandas`库实现表关联与模糊条件匹配,并配以代码示例,帮助读者更好
原创
2024-09-03 06:00:51
125阅读